Output 95264319c9b255d449494a094d18b35c907f25aecb5df1a72273834c59f788db:65

value
1317118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26c4a79d6712dc82561983fa7e02cd6a8591bb26 OP_EQUAL
address
35E1BeLbH9qPGfTv14TeuyTi21kw1B9WNy
transaction
95264319c9b255d449494a094d18b35c907f25aecb5df1a72273834c59f788db
spent
true